JOB SUMMARY

Qualifications & ExperienceEducation: Masters in relevant field or equivalent experience in operations, strategy, or venture building.Experience: 3–6 years in start-ups or project management (exposure to creative industries, education, or social ventures would be a bonus).

RESPONSIBILITIES

Launch planning and executionTranslate the program concept into a concrete, phased launch roadmap, covering community consultations, creative camps, and the first pilot programs.Drive delivery of early milestones: identify locations, secure partners, and coordinate logistics for events and pilots.Manage day-to-day operations during the build phase, anticipating bottlenecks and problem-solving quickly.Build systems for tracking timelines, budgets, and KPIs to keep the project on schedule.Business model and operationsDevelop and manage detailed budgets and operational systems suited to a lean, start-up phase.Maintain strong cost discipline: identify ways to economize and make efficient use of limited resources.Support the design of governance, HR, and admissions processes as the initiative evolves into a permanent institution.Prepare draft business models, funding scenarios, and cost-recovery plans to guide long-term sustainability.Partnerships and ecosystem-buildingEngage with creative schools, local institutions, and international partners to build the early network behind the school.Support mapping of funders and investors in the creative economy; coordinate outreach and proposal materials.Help establish and service an advisory committee of educators, practitioners, and industry experts.Represent the project in meetings and events with ministries, cultural organisations, and community stakeholders.Project management and communicationMaintain clear dashboards, trackers, and deliverables that support agile decision-making.Prepare succinct decks, briefs, and progress updates for senior leadership, trustees, and external partners.Ensure alignment across internal teams and any external consultants (if applicable).Regulatory compliance and legal setupResearch and understand the regulatory landscape for post-secondary education and design an implementation roadmap for the right registration and certification setup.Explore partnerships with global institutions for co-certification programs.Work with the organisation’s finance and legal team to establish a solid legal structure.Builder mindsetApproach the role with a founder’s mentality: proactive, accountable, and unafraid to take initiative.Willing to go beyond regular hours or step outside formal job boundaries when needed to move the project forward.Operate with integrity, humility, and discretion, building trust internally and externally.Treat every challenge as an opportunity to shape something lasting and distinctive for the region
